Controle da Radio

Enviada por Vinicius 
Vinicius
Controle da Radio
19 de November de 2007 às 03:13PM
Ola Amigos!
Estou com o seguinte problema, tenho uma radio na pagina do meu blog, o usuário clicar em STOP no player, quando ele clica para ir para outra categoria do site o player volta a reproduzir automaticamente, estou querendo criar um controle em php, bem simples, para o usuário clicar em STOP e quando for para outra pagina continuar no estado que usuário deixou(Stop/Reproduzindo).

olha o codigo"<?
session_start();
$radio = $_GET['acao'];

$_SESSION['radio']= $radio;


if($_SESSION['radio']==1){
echo"

<!-- Player -->
<a href='http://www.radiowebtuner.net' target='_blank'><img border='0' width='200' src='http://i195.photobucket.com/albums/z303/viniciusvams/logorodrigo.gif' height='100'/></a><br>
<object align='middle' codebase='http://activex.microsoft.com/activex/controls/mplayer/en/nsmp2inf.cab#Version=5,1,52,701' type='application/x-oleobject' height='70' id='SubmusicaPlayer' standby='Carregando componentes do Microsoft® Windows Media Player...' width='396' classid='CLSID:22d6f312-b0f6-11d0-94ab-0080c74c7e95'>
<param ref='' value='http://stream.provedor.pro.br:8102' name='FileName' valuetype='ref'/>
<param value='-1' name='animationatStart'/>
<param value='-1' name='transparentatStart'/>
<param value='-1' name='autoStart'/>
<param value='-1' name='showControls'/>

<param value='-1' name='ShowStatusBar'/>
<param value='0' name='ShowDisplay'/>
<param value='0' name='ShowCaptioning'/>
<param value='-1' name='AudioStream'/>
<param value='0' name='AutoSize'/>
<param value='-1' name='AllowScan'/>
<param value='-1' name='AllowChangeDisplaySize'/>
<param value='0' name='AutoRewind'/>
<param value='0' name='Balance'/>

<param value='' name='BaseURL'/>
<param value='5' name='BufferingTime'/>
<param value='' name='CaptioningID'/>
<param value='-1' name='ClickToPlay'/>
<param value='0' name='CursorType'/>
<param value='-1' name='CurrentPosition'/>
<param value='0' name='CurrentMarker'/>
<param value='' name='DefaultFrame'/>

<param value='0' name='DisplayBackColor'/>

<param value='16777215' name='DisplayForeColor'/>
<param value='0' name='DisplayMode'/>
<param value='4' name='DisplaySize'/>
<param value='-1' name='Enabled'/>
<param value='-1' name='EnableContextMenu'/>
<param value='-1' name='EnablePositionControls'/>
<param value='0' name='EnableFullScreenControls'/>

<param value='-1' name='EnableTracker'/>
<param value='-1' name='InvokeURLs'/>

<param value='-1' name='Language'/>
<param value='0' name='Mute'/>
<param value='0' name='PlayCount'/>
<param value='0' name='PreviewMode'/>
<param value='1' name='Rate'/>
<param value='' name='SAMILang'/>

<param value='' name='SAMIStyle'/>
<param value='' name='SAMIFileName'/>
<param value='-1' name='SelectionStart'/>

<param value='-1' name='SelectionEnd'/>
<param value='-1' name='SendOpenStateChangeEvents'/>
<param value='-1' name='SendWarningEvents'/>
<param value='-1' name='SendErrorEvents'/>
<param value='0' name='SendKeyboardEvents'/>

<param value='0' name='SendMouseClickEvents'/>
<param value='0' name='SendMouseMoveEvents'/>
<param value='-1' name='SendPlayStateChangeEvents'/>
<param value='-1' name='ShowAudioControls'/>

<param value='0' name='ShowGotoBar'/>
<param value='-1' name='ShowPositionControls'/>
<param value='-1' name='ShowTracker'/>
<param value='0' name='VideoBorderWidth'/>

<param value='0' name='VideoBorderColor'/>
<param value='0' name='VideoBorder3D'/>
<param value='-600' name='Volume'/>
<param value='0' name='WindowlessVideo'/>
<embed bgcolor='darkblue' autostart='False' loop='False' width='200' autosize='-1' showcontrols='true' showstatusbar='-1' showdisplay='0' displaysize='4' videoborder3d='-1' id='dnbol' src='http://72.232.111.58:8102' showtracker='0' type='application/x-mplayer2' pluginspage='http://microsoft.com/windows/mediaplayer/en/download/' height='70' designtimesp='5311'></embed></object>

<!-- Fim Player -->
<form method='GET' action='#'>
<input type='hidden' name='acao' value=0>
<input type='submit' value='Para de Reproduzir'>
</form>";

} else {

echo"Escute a Radio Clicando no Botão Abaixo!";
echo"
<form method='GET' action='#'>
<input type='hidden' name='acao' value=1>
<input type='submit' value='Reproduzir a Radio'>
</form>";
}

?>
"

só que continua com o mesmo problema, quando o cara recarrega a pagina, parece que a session perde o valor da variavel ($radio), o que faço para resolver isso.

Obrigado!
Você precisa estar logado no PHPBrasil.com para poder enviar mensagens para os nossos fóruns.

Faça o login aqui.